LS Group and HAI in Austria will build a 100 billion won joint plant in Gumi

[Alpha Biz=(Chicago) Reporter Paul Lee] Gumi City announced on the 25th that it has attracted a joint factory between LS Group and HAI·Hammerer Aluminum Industries, a global aluminum manufacturer.
HAI is the world's No. 1 company in aluminum parts for electric vehicles (EV) and operates plants in four European countries, including Austria and Germany, to supply products to Daimler and BMW.
The joint venture, which will be worth 100 billion won at the Gumi 3rd Industrial Complex, will produce high-strength lightweight aluminum parts for EVs, including battery cases, starting in 2025.
LS Cable, which has supplied high-strength aluminum parts to Hyundai and Kia's internal combustion locomotives, plans to expand its business around EV with the establishment of a joint venture with HAI to establish a value chain that leads to LS Materials' energy, LS Alsco's eco-friendly materials and LS-HAI JV's aluminum parts.
